    We didn't like a few minor things we found in our lodge. One was a broken wine glass found in the cupboard, a t shirt in the bottom of a wardrobe, a 1 inch nail my son trod on found in a bedroom, and my bedside lamp was not working. I have both emailed and let the team know in person about this, and was advised I would be contacted by a manager, but haven't yet, but not sure what they can do really for us, other than improve things for the next guests, Also, not the hotel's fault, but a suggestion would be to have numbered parking spaces allocated per lodge. We were supposed to have 2 spaces, but were lucky to have found 1 in a separate designated parking bay not next to the lodges (many spaces double parked right outside our lodge).

    We liked the lodge location, and the view of the golf course from our balcony. The greens looked appealing to my husband whom is a keen golfer. We also were warmly greeted by the staff that we passed by as we used the facilities. We could not find the hair dryer (it was not where the instructions said it would be). We rang reception using the lodge's phone, and were told where it was (under the stairs), we couldn't find it and the lady on reception brought us the dryer. It was there, but our coats were hiding it. There was a iron and ironing board which is always handy. TV was good, we brought our Apple TV and the wifi was perfect for streaming (no lag). We had brekkie for about £16/£17 per person, and this was alright, service good. We also ate lunch in the clubhouse which was also good. We also used the gym, the pool and spa facilities which were all good also, as were the staff. Overall, my husband enjoyed our stay, which was paramount, as it was to celebrate a milestone birthday. We had booked a meal over at Lympstone Manor and this hotel was a short drive away, and half the cost.
